Report: Talk of Climate-Focused Transit Is Empty When CA Still Prioritizes Investment in Automobility
Researchers at the University of California looked at California's progress on climate-focused transit promises and proposals - and find that the state focuses only TWO PERCENT of its funding there. The rest goes towards making driving easier.

Bay Area Begins to Roll Out E-Bike Incentives Under Clean Cars 4 All
Income- and zip-code qualifying households in the Bay Area can exchange an old gas guzzler for an electric cargo bike, or several e-bikes and transit passes; other regions will also eventually launch their programs
